Output 051034eb1e66a757ed2c738a1c88e04feb392647a4fc8c17ddee59af5791d7cc:4

value
600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 692eead30a281030570bf150da6916921223c545 OP_EQUAL
address
3BHB5ZCJQDtPmaNyPVK2ku7ASBgUmYz1ko
transaction
051034eb1e66a757ed2c738a1c88e04feb392647a4fc8c17ddee59af5791d7cc
confirmations
76811
spent
true